The best method to keep away from getting burned from splashed wax is to make use of a candle snuffer as a substitute of blowing on the flame. A candle snuffer is normally temperature of candle wax a small metallic cup on the tip of a protracted deal with. Placing the snuffer over the flame cuts off the oxygen provide.

As in Europe, these candles have been pretty costly, and most commoners used oil lamps as a substitute. Elites, although, may afford to spend massive sums on expensive candles. For example, the Abbasid caliph al-Mutawakkil spent 1.2 million silver dirhams yearly on candles for his royal palaces. Wicks are sometimes infused with a variety of chemical substances to change their burning characteristics. For instance, it is often fascinating that the wick not glow after the flame is extinguished. Typical agents are ammonium nitrate and ammonium sulfate.
